C#中的模型层中的实体类,是我们做数据库连接不可缺少的类。每次我们需要手动打实体类
那有没有什么办法可以实现自动生成实体类呢?
今天分享一个自动生成实体类的工具
这个生成器没有和数据库链接生成实体类,因为有时候做数据库的视图、存储过程或是使用联合查询也是很费事的(因为我个人是比较懒的,不太喜欢写视图或是存储过程或是联合查询什么的),所有我就自己为自己做了一个小的实体类生成器,简单的输入类名、字段名以及字段的类型,单击按钮就可以生成一个实体类。 用到的控件很简单地,label、textbox、checkbox、button、datagirdview
www.ibcibc.com C#,IBC编程社区
这是简单的界面 单击“添加”按钮可以频繁地添加需要的字段以及类型添加到右侧的datagridview中。 代码实现的时候因为是自己使用没有使用MVC结构
www.ibcibc.com C#,IBC编程社区
创建一个实体类用来存储字段名、类型、get方法以及set方法, 因为获取的datagridview的数据居是一条一条获得地。
www.ibcibc.com C#,IBC编程社区
“添加”按钮的单击事件,实现数据的绑定在datagridview中的显示。
www.ibcibc.com C#,IBC编程社区
在“生成实体类”button的单击事件中实现的文件的生成,具体的都是控件的使用网上会有很多空间使用的介绍。 所有的都是手动生成的,所以不需要DBHelper
|